			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>A Northwest dairy producer has agreed to pay $260,000 to settle a sexual harassment and retaliation suit.</p>
<p>Wilcox Farms, Inc., which has production facilities in Washington and Oregon, denied any wrongdoing but agreed to pay a former employee who said she was harassed by her supervisor, the U.S. Equal Employment Opportunity Commission said today.</p>
<p>The EEOC filed the lawsuit on behalf of Diana Dominguez, claiming that her boss grabbed, propositioned and tried to undress her at Wilcox Farms&#8217; Aurora plant. The suit also asserted that Wilcox retaliated by pressuring Dominguez to resign and forcing her to continue to work for the same supervisor. Ultimately, Dominguez quit.</p>
<p>In addition to paying its former employee, Wilcox Farms also agreed to distribute a sexual harassment policy in English and Spanish and to conduct workshops for all its employees.<br />
